Disturbing Reasons Not to Trust the News (From a Reporter)

aaa_241005_v2.jpg

#1. Respected Journalists Are Often Shills: Journalists have to cope with a lot: dwindling budgets, shrinking salaries, the defenestration of fact checking, agenda-driven reports from think tanks, corporate "crisis" teams deliberately making their lives harder -- no problem. The need for a bullshit filter is right there in the job description, just under "cool hat." But some writers end up bypassing their own filter for political point-scoring or cash. Even lauded New York Times best-seller Malcolm Gladwell got his start suckling at the teat of big business.
